About the role

  • Leading a financial controllership team to ensure financial and statutory compliance across regions. Collaborating with various departments and managing strategic financial processes.

Responsibilities

  • Leading a Regional Financial Controllership Team and responsible for ensuring excellent financials, management accounting, tax, and statutory compliance service is provided throughout the sub region
  • Managing, training, developing, and motivating a regional financial controllership team of approx. 7 to 10 professionals
  • Stewardship and review of financial documents for group and local compliance
  • Performance and evidence of Controls
  • Ensure appropriateness of controls for internal and external compliance
  • Regular balance sheet and cost reviews
  • Supervise the month end close process for the region supported and ensuring critical processes and reconciliation obligations are met
  • Leading primary relationship with Regional Tax department, Finance, Internal Audit, Treasury, General Accounting, Group & Statutory Auditors, and outsource partners

Requirements

  • Qualified Accountant from a recognised professional institute (CIMA/ACCA/CA) or with a Degree in Accounting/ Finance from a recognised university with 7-9 years of experience
  • Candidates with part qualification/ degree and proven experience also considered
  • Experience of using Oracle, HFM, Blackline accounting systems
  • Strong background in preparation of Statutory accounts across multiple entities
  • Financial accounting in a large organisation
  • Strong IFRS knowledge
  • Strong understanding of accounting concepts
  • Experience in working with senior interested parties and reporting to tight deadlines
  • Experience of leading cross geography relationships
  • Strong Excel skills and be confident in leading sophisticated spreadsheets to ensure accurate reporting
  • Ability to scope and shape role while adapting to fast changing environment
  • Strong process orientation, with ability to design and operate robust reporting frameworks
  • Ability to build strong working relationships with global colleagues
  • Effective oral and written communication that resonates with the target audience
